About Residence by Investment Law in Indianapolis, United States:

Residence by Investment is a legal process that allows individuals to obtain a residence permit in Indianapolis, United States by making a qualifying investment in the country. This can include investing in real estate, starting a business, or other approved investments. Residence by Investment can provide a pathway to permanent residency or even citizenship in some cases.

Local Laws Overview:

In Indianapolis, United States, Residence by Investment is governed by federal immigration laws, as well as any specific regulations related to investor immigration programs. It is essential to understand the legal requirements and documentation needed for a successful Residence by Investment application, as well as any potential risks or challenges that may arise.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What types of investments qualify for Residence by Investment in Indianapolis?

Qualifying investments for Residence by Investment in Indianapolis can include real estate purchases, business investments, and other approved investment opportunities.

2. How long does the Residence by Investment process take in Indianapolis?

The processing times for Residence by Investment applications can vary depending on the specific program and individual circumstances. It is recommended to consult with a legal expert for an accurate timeline.

3. Is there a minimum investment amount required for Residence by Investment in Indianapolis?

Yes, there is typically a minimum investment amount required to qualify for Residence by Investment in Indianapolis. The specific amount can vary depending on the program.

4. Can my family members also obtain residence permits through my investment?

Many Residence by Investment programs in Indianapolis allow for family members to be included in the application, providing them with residence permits as well.

5. What are the benefits of obtaining residency through investment in Indianapolis?

Residence by Investment can provide individuals with the opportunity to live, work, and study in Indianapolis, access healthcare and other social services, and potentially qualify for permanent residency or citizenship.

6. What are the risks associated with Residence by Investment in Indianapolis?

Some risks of Residence by Investment in Indianapolis can include financial loss if the investment does not perform as expected, as well as potential legal challenges or complications during the application process.

7. Can I work in Indianapolis with a residence permit obtained through investment?

With a residence permit obtained through investment in Indianapolis, individuals may be eligible to work legally in the country, depending on the specific program requirements.

8. Are there any restrictions on the types of investments that qualify for Residence by Investment in Indianapolis?

While there are generally approved investment categories for Residence by Investment in Indianapolis, it is essential to consult with legal experts to ensure compliance with all applicable laws and regulations.

9. How can a lawyer help me with my Residence by Investment application in Indianapolis?

A lawyer can assist with preparing and submitting the necessary documentation, navigating legal requirements, negotiating investment agreements, and addressing any legal issues that may arise during the Residence by Investment process.

10. What is the difference between Residence by Investment and Citizenship by Investment in Indianapolis?

Residence by Investment provides individuals with a residence permit in Indianapolis, allowing them to live and work in the country. Citizenship by Investment, on the other hand, grants individuals citizenship in addition to residency rights.
